full-length
    adj 1: representing or accommodating the entire length; "a full-
           length portrait"
    2: complete; "the full-length play" [syn: {full-length},
       {uncut}]

full-length \full-length\ adj.
   1. accommodating the full height of the human figure; as, a
      full-length mirror.
      [WordNet 1.5]

   2. representing the full height of the human figure; as, a
      full-length portrait.
      [WordNet 1.5]

   3. unabridged; as, the full-length play. Opposite of
      {abridged}.

   Syn: complete, uncut.
